Economy & Jobs

The median household income in Waterford is $75,968, roughly in line with the national average of $75,149. Unemployment stands at 4.8%, indicating a healthy job market. Only 1.7% of residents live below the poverty line, well below the national rate of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 30 minutes.

Cost of Living & Housing

The median home value in Waterford is $245,600, 13% below the national median / off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$1,618 per month, significantly above the national average of $1,163. A price-to-income ratio of 3.2x indicates a reasonably affordable housing market.

Safety & Crime

Waterford is a very safe community with a violent crime rate of 43 per 100,000 residents / well below the national average of 380. Property crime occurs at a rate of 1,005 per 100,000, 49% below the national average.

Education

25.5%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 95.5%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.1/10 in standardized testing, reflecting strong academic performance.

Climate & Weather

Waterford experiences four distinct seasons with an average temperature of 51°F. Winters average 31°F in January while summers reach 72°F in July. With 275 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 39.3 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 39.

Waterford has a population of 3,496 with a density of 1,850 people per square mile, spread across 1.9 square miles. The median age is 45.7 years, 17% older than the national median of 38.9. The gender split is 53.3% female and 46.7% male. The city is predominantly White (76.9%), with 3.1% Hispanic, 8.2% Black. English is the primary language spoken at home by 92.1% of residents, while 7.9% speak Spanish. 9.3% of the population are veterans, above the national rate of 6.0%. 18.0% of residents have a disability (above the 13.0% national average). 98.3% have health insurance coverage.

The median household income in Waterford is $75,968, which is 1%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$44,756 (above the $39,052 national figure). The average weekly wage is $1,356. The unemployment rate is 4.8% (above the 3.6% US average). 1.7% of residents live below the poverty line, lower than the national rate of 12.4%. The area has 9,101 business establishments, including 773 restaurants. The cost of living index is 103.6, roughly in line with the national average. Workers commute an average of 30 minutes. 6.0% of workers work from home (below the 15.2% national rate).

The median home value in Waterford is $245,600, 13%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home value at $404,290, higher than the Census estimate. Homes sell for 100.5% of their list price, indicating a competitive market where bidding wars are common. Monthly rent averages $1,618 (39% above the national average of $1,163). Fair market rent ranges from $1,590 for a one-bedroom to $1,955 for a two-bedroom apartment. 68.6% of housing units are owner-occupied. There are 1,589 total housing units in the city. The median year a home was built is 1968. The average annual property tax is $7,070 (higher than the $3,500 national average). 27.6% of renters spend 30% or more of their income on housing. The home price-to-income ratio is 3.2x.
